About PROJECT DREAM

PROJECT DREAM is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1181846).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Good Standing" rating with a CharityScore of 68/100 — a charity in good standing with solid but not exceptional governance indicators. This reflects adequate performance across most criteria, though some areas fall short of the strongest-rated charities. In its most recent reporting year (2024), PROJECT DREAM reported a total income of £330 and total expenditure of £330, a spending ratio of 100% which is broadly in line with its income. According to the Charity Commission register, PROJECT DREAM describes its activities as follows: Independently founded up by myself and wife Andrea Reis in 2012, Project Dream is about providing education support through school learning materials to schools in various communities in Bradford, providing safe drinking water by digging water wells, providing reusable feminine hygiene cups to girls in the region, supporting the local clinics with over the counter syrups, toys for Christmas.
